I have rigorously worked on Physics, and Mathematics during my 11th and 12th for preparing for IIT JEE exam and hence have a good hands on experience of learning from a coaching institute, at the same time I put on the shoes of a teacher in REWODU where in I taught those subjects to the students and have really taken into consideration that the slowest student should also be able to understand the subject enough to loose the fear of it.
The student interaction was the best part of the job because that's where I realized what can be improved in teaching to incorporate every single students needs although it requires a special attention to everyone. Hence I moved to a coaching institute where the batch size would be small enough that I can concentrate on every individual students. Students were the key for me to continue my endeavor as a teacher because their appreciation and curiosity makes me work hard every day.

Answered on 04/03/2016 Learn Tuition/Class IX-X Tuition

Originally oxidation reactions were identified as the reactions in which oxygen gas participates. There, oxygen combines with another molecule to produce an oxide. In this reaction, oxygen undergoes reduction and the other substance undergoes oxidation. Therefore, basically, the oxidation reaction is adding oxygen to another substance. For example, in the following reaction, hydrogen undergoes oxidation and, therefore, oxygen atom has added to hydrogen forming water. 2H2 + O2 -> 2H2O Another way to describe oxidation is as loss of hydrogen. There are some occasions where it is hard to describe oxidation as adding oxygen. For example, in the following reaction, oxygen has added to both carbon and hydrogen, but only carbon has undergone oxidation. In this instance, oxidation can be described by saying it is the loss of hydrogen. As hydrogens have removed from methane when producing carbon dioxide, carbon there has been oxidized. CH4 + 2O2 -> CO2 + 2H2O Another alternative approach to describing oxidation is as losing of electrons. This approach can be used to explain chemical reactions, where we can’t see an oxide formation or hydrogen losing. So, even when there is no oxygen, we can explain oxidation using this approach. For example in the following reaction, magnesium has converted to magnesium ions. Since magnesium has lost two electrons it has undergone oxidation and chlorine gas is the oxidizing agent. Mg + Cl2 -> Mg2+ + 2Cl- Combustion or heating is a reaction where heat is produced by an exothermic reaction. For the reaction to take place, a fuel and an oxidant should be there Combustion is an oxidation reaction. • For combustion, the usual oxidant is oxygen but, for an oxidation reaction to take place, oxygen is not essential. • In combustion, the products are primarily water and carbon dioxide but, in oxidation, the product can vary depending on the starting material. However, always they will have a higher oxidation state than the reactants. • In combustion reactions, heat and light are produced, and work can be done from the energy. But for oxidation reactions, this is not always true.
